star-1
star-2
icon-trophyicon-trophy-dark
icon-locationicon-location-dark
icon-globeicon-globe-dark
icon-crownicon-crown-dark
icon-diamondicon-diamond-dark
icon-chaticon-chat-dark
informatique

Formation Créer des Applications Web Progressives Performantes et Engageantes

Maîtrisez la création de Progressive Web Apps (PWA). Apprenez à développer des applications web rapides, fiables et engageantes. Optimisez l'expérience utilisateur, même hors ligne. Déployez une solution multiplateforme performante. Devenez expert en PWA pour moderniser vos applications web.

PrésentielDistanciel21 hCréer des Applications Web Progressives Performantes et EngageantesOPCOFAFFranceTravailCPFRégionFNE Formation

Réponse sous 24h ouvré

Ce que vous apprendrez durant
la formation Créer des Applications Web Progressives Performantes et Engageantes

Concevoir et développer une PWA installable

Capacité à structurer une application web avec un Manifest et un Service Worker pour la rendre installable, rapide et accessible, offrant une expérience utilisateur au plus proche d'une application native, prête pour l'ajout à l'écran d'accueil.

Gérer le mode hors ligne et la persistance des données

Maîtriser les stratégies de caching avec les Service Workers et Workbox, ainsi que les APIs de stockage (IndexedDB, LocalStorage) et de synchronisation pour garantir une fonctionnalité robuste et fiable même sans connexion internet.

Optimiser les performances et la sécurité d'une PWA

Aptitude à auditer, améliorer la vitesse de chargement et l'engagement d'une PWA, tout en assurant une sécurité optimale via HTTPS et des bonnes pratiques de développement pour protéger l'application et les données utilisateurs.

Déployer et maintenir des PWA multiplateformes

Savoir déployer une PWA sur un hébergeur adéquat, gérer ses mises à jour, son suivi analytique et son évolution continue, assurant sa pérennité et sa performance sur divers appareils et systèmes d'exploitation.

starsstar

La formation parfaite pour :

Développeurs Web Front-end

Pour les développeurs souhaitant moderniser leurs applications web, maîtriser les dernières technologies et offrir une expérience utilisateur exceptionnelle, même hors ligne. Passez au niveau supérieur du développement web.

Chefs de Projet Techniques

Concepteurs UX/UI

Pour les designers soucieux de l'expérience utilisateur et de la performance. Apprenez comment les PWA améliorent l'engagement, la vitesse et l'accessibilité de vos interfaces, y compris en mode déconnecté. Optimisez vos conceptions.

Entrepreneurs / Startups

Pour les fondateurs cherchant à bâtir des solutions robustes et multiplateformes avec un coût de développement optimisé. Découvrez comment les PWA peuvent accélérer votre mise sur le marché et toucher un public plus large.

Programme de la formation
Créer des Applications Web Progressives Performantes et Engageantes

  • Introduction aux PWA et à leurs bénéfices

    - Définition et historique des Progressive Web Apps
    - Comparaison PWA vs Applications Natives vs Sites Web classiques
    - Les bénéfices des PWA pour l'utilisateur et le développeur (coût, maintenance, SEO)
    - Anatomie d'une PWA : les technologies clés (HTTPS, Manifest, Service Workers)
    - Prérequis techniques et environnement de développement

  • Le Web App Manifest : l'identité de votre PWA

    - Comprendre le rôle et la structure du Web App Manifest
    - Les propriétés essentielles : nom, icônes, thème, mode d'affichage
    - Intégration du Manifest dans le code HTML
    - Outils de validation et de débogage du Manifest (Lighthouse)
    - La notion d'ajout à l'écran d'accueil (Add to Homescreen - A2HS)

  • Les Service Workers : la fondation de l'offline

    - Introduction aux Service Workers : cycle de vie et rôle
    - Enregistrement et activation d'un Service Worker
    - Interception des requêtes réseau (fetch event)
    - Mise en cache des ressources statiques (App Shell)
    - Stratégies de caching : Cache First, Network First, Stale While Revalidate

  • Stratégies de caching avancées et fichiers dynamiques
  • Gestion de l'état hors ligne et données persistantes

    - Détection et gestion de la connectivité réseau
    - Stockage des données locales : IndexedDB et LocalStorage
    - Synchronisation des données en arrière-plan (Background Sync API)
    - Communication entre la page web et le Service Worker
    - Notification des changements d'état à l'utilisateur

  • Engagement utilisateur : Les notifications push
  • Fonctionnalités avancées des PWA et API modernes

    - Intégration de la géolocalisation et des capteurs de l'appareil
    - Accès aux fichiers (File System Access API)
    - Partage de contenu (Web Share API)
    - Fonctionnalités spécifiques aux PWA (Badging API, Wake Lock API)
    - Exploration des capacitées croissantes des PWA

  • Optimisation des performances des PWA
  • Sécurité des PWA : le rôle essentiel de HTTPS

    - Comprendre l'importance de HTTPS pour les PWA
    - Configuration d'un certificat SSL/TLS
    - Protection contre les attaques communes (XSS, CSRF)
    - Bonnes pratiques de sécurité pour les Service Workers
    - Considérations de sécurité lors de l'accès aux APIs natives

  • Déploiement et publication d'une PWA

    - Choisir un hébergeur compatible PWA
    - Configuration du serveur web pour le Manifest et les Service Workers
    - Déploiement via des plateformes comme Netlify, Vercel ou Firebase Hosting
    - Stratégies de mise à jour des PWA en production
    - Suivi et maintenance post-déploiement

  • Monétisation et analyse des PWA

    - Stratégies de monétisation pour les PWA (publicité, abonnements)
    - Intégration d'outils d'analyse (Google Analytics, Matomo)
    - Suivi des conversions et de l'engagement utilisateur
    - Analyse des performances et des retours utilisateurs
    - Amélioration continue basée sur les données

  • Bonnes pratiques et futur des PWA

    - Checklist pour une PWA performante et robuste
    - Tests unitaires et d'intégration pour les Service Workers
    - Accessibilité (A11y) pour les PWA
    - Tendances futures des PWA et du développement web
    - Étude de cas de PWA réussies et retours d'expériences

Encore des questions ?

Nous pouvons adapter le programme de la formation Créer des Applications Web Progressives Performantes et Engageantes à vos besoins. Contactez un conseiller en formation

Avatar-imageAvatar-image
Nous contacter
FAQs

Questions souvents posées

Vous avez des interrogations ? Nous avons les réponses. Consultez notre FAQ pour découvrir les questions que d’autres se posent souvent avant de se lancer dans une formation.

Vous avez encore des questions ?
  • Prérequis

    - Maîtrise des fondamentaux de JavaScript. - Connaissances de base en HTML et CSS. - Familiarité avec les concepts du développement web côté client (DOM, événements). - Connaissance de l'anglais technique (documentation).

  • - Un ordinateur portable fonctionnel (Windows, macOS ou Linux). - Un éditeur de code (VS Code, Sublime Text, etc.) installé. - Un navigateur web moderne (Google Chrome fortement recommandé pour les outils de développement). - Une connexion Internet stable pour le téléchargement des outils et l'accès aux ressources.

  • 5 tests d'évaluation sont proposés à l'apprenant en fin de formation pour connaître son niveau sur chaque compétences visées.

  • Plateforme et contenus e-learning à disposition. Test de positionnement Quizz & Evaluations

  • Nous vous recevons lors d’un rendez-vous d’information préalable gratuit et confidentiel en visioconférence pour analyser vos besoins et co-construire votre parcours personnalisé. Chaque demande s’accompagne de la remise d’une convention ou d’un contrat précisant l’ensemble des informations relatives à la formation (Tarifs, calendrier, durée, lieu…). Ce contrat/convention sera transmis électroniquement par email.

  • A partir de l’accord de prise en charge par le financeur sollicité, le bénéficiaire peut démarrer sous un délai de 11 jours ouvrés. Si vous financez votre parcours de formation par vos propres moyens, alors le délai d'accès est immédiat. Vous pouvez entrer en formation tout au long de l’année.

  • ♿️ Nous accueillons les personnes en situation de handicap. Les conditions d’accessibilité aux personnes handicapées sont inscrites sur le site imi-education.fr, rubrique Accessibilité.

  • Jaylan Nikolovski Pour tout renseignement : 06 72 09 69 52 / jaylan.n@imi-executive-solutions.com

  • 25 juin 2025

appostrof

Obtenez le meilleur de la formation professionnelle

Pourquoi choisir imi executive solutions ? ¯\_(ツ)_/¯

feature-icon

Mille formations en une seule !

Les meilleures formations réunies en une seule. Apprenez tous ce qu'il y a à savoir.

feature-icon

Présentiel ou distanciel

Inter ou intra, apprenez au côté de professionnels en activité.

feature-icon

Apprendre en faisant

Pédagogie active où l’apprenant est acteur de son propre apprentissage : construisez, créez, expérimentez !

feature-icon

Ingénierie de financement 👩🏼‍💻

Notre expertise au service de l'optimisation de vos budgets de formation.(OPCO, FSE+, FNE, FAF, CPF, EDEF)

feature-icon

E-Learning 💻

Accès illimité à tous les contenus (supports, cours, vidéos, exercices, templates)

feature-icon

Parcours sur-mesure

Nous adaptons le programme de la formation en fonction des besoins de votre entreprise

Notre révolution pédagogique est en marche

Des formations sur-mesure qui répondent à vos ambitions stratégiques.

Tarifs et solutions de financement

Pour les formations intraentreprise, nos tarifs ne dépendent pas du nombre de stagiaires. Notre organisme de formation est certifié Qualiopi

Avec un formateur

En inter ou en intra, en présentiel ou à distance, bénéficiez de l’accompagnement d’experts à la fois formateurs et professionnels de terrain.

Sur devis
Sessions programmées avec formateur
Avantages :
Accompagnement personnalisé
Sessions en visio ou en présentiel
Échanges interactifs avec un formateur expert
Supports de formation inclus
Certificat de fin de formation

Sans formateur

Des formations e-learning flexibles, accessibles à tout moment, pour monter en compétences à votre rythme.

Sur devis
Accès en ligne illimité pendant 6 mois
Avantages :
Accès 24h/24 aux modules en ligne
Vidéos, quiz et ressources téléchargeables
Auto-évaluation des acquis
Avancement à son rythme
Assistance technique incluse

Accès imi+

Les entreprises peuvent abonner leurs collaborateurs un accès illimité à l’ensemble de nos formations.

99
Accès multi-collaborateurs via abonnement entreprise
Avantages :
Accès illimité au catalogue pour vos équipes
Tableau de bord pour suivre les apprenants
Formations e-learning et sessions sur mesure
Gestion centralisée des accès
Devis personnalisé selon vos besoins

Le champ de la formation est exonéré de TVA.

Les financements possibles

Notre métier est aussi de vous accompagner dans l'activation des différents financeurs pour vous éviter le moins de reste à charge possible.

A la fin de cette formation, ajoutez sur votre CV :

Créer des Applications Web Progressives Performantes et Engageantes

Obtenez la certification Créer des Applications Web Progressives Performantes et Engageantes délivrée par i.m.i. executive solutions.

Try it now

Formations à la une

Nos publications récentes

starsstar

Prêt·e à transformer vos compétences ?

Découvrez l'impact concret de notre programme sur vos problématiques quotidiennes

Réponse sous 48h